The Super Bowl will return to Atlanta in 2028 at the home of the Falcons, following a vote of approval by NFL team owners on Tuesday at the league's annual fall meeting.

The Mercedes-Benz Stadium is prepared ahead of the NFL Super Bowl 53 football game in Atlanta on Feb. 3, 2019. The Super Bowl will return to Atlanta in 2028 at the home of the Falcons, following a vote of approval by NFL team owners on Tuesday at the league's annual fall meeting.
